The highest wind gust reported was 107 mph in Lamar. Westcliffe recorded wind gust of 90 mph, and 70 mph winds were reported at the Buena Vista Airport.

The Boys and Girls Clubs of Chaffee County, and the nearly thousand local youth they serve each year, just received a huge boost from the Chaffee County Department of Human Services and Chaffee County Board of County Commissioners in the form of a half-million-dollar cash donation.
